WARRANTY
Bridgewerks provides technical support free of charge, regardless of how long you have had your controller.
Somemes an issue can be xed over the phone, saving the cost of shipping and geng your railroad
running faster.
Parts and labor are warranted for a period of 5 years. If your Bridgewerks Product requires repair, ship it
back to Bridgewerks, We will repair or replace it and return it to you. If your warranty has expired, or is
not registered, there will be a charge for repair and shipping.
If a unit is returned for repair and no problem is found, there will be a $25 service charge.
Return Freight Policy: Customer is responsible for return freight; you will be advised the amount when
your unit is ready for return.
Warranty does not cover repairs to damage caused by misuse or abuse. Please do not leave this product
outdoors: unplug the quick disconnect plugs and bring it indoors when it is not in use.
Be sure to keep the packaging just in case your unit ever does need to be returned for service. Some of our
products are very heavy, and the special packaging is designed specically to protect the internal parts and
cosmecs of the product.
Please take a moment to ll out the Warranty card in the box or online at Bridgewerks.com and return it to
us.

Mag Mate Features
• Connecons:
On the rear of the Mag Mate there are two
pairs of connectors—one is labelled ‘To is a
pair of connectors labelled ‘TO TRACK’ and the
other is for the connecon to your power
supply. The power source can be any 18-
26VDC power supply, such as a Bridgewerks
power controller, or a Mag-15 power supply.
Your Mag Mate came with a short cable with
‘banana plugs’ on either end—plug one end of
this cable into the back of the Mag Mate, and
the other into the accessory power output of
your power controller. When doing this be
careful to match red to red, and black to black.
The second pair of terminals is to connect the
Mag Mate to your track. If the track is con-
nected with the red on the right rail, and the
black on the le rail, then the train will move
forward when power is applied. If it goes
backwards, you can just ip the banana con-
nector over to reverse the polarity.

• Wire:
Use heavy gauge wire to connect your power controller to the track. For distances of up to 15 feet,
you should use 12 gauge wire. For distances over 15 , you use 10 gauge wire. Although the track
itself is similar to a very heavy gauge wire, in larger layouts, signicant loss can occur from the
connecons between secons of track. To improve this, run mulple power connecons to the
track from the controller and/or use track clamps rather than slider type couplers. In outdoor
layouts which are exposed to extreme temperatures, the track will expand and contract as the
temperature changes, and slider type couplers may have to be used.
• Outdoor operaon
Garden railways are oen installed outdoors and Bridgewerks controllers are built to be used with
outdoor railroad layouts. However, they are not waterproof, and as with any electronic equipment,
they should not be le outdoors when not in use. To make this easy, the connecons are all made so
that they can simply be unplugged and the controller can be carried indoors.
• Momentum:
The Mag Mate features an adjustable momentum control which will limit the acceleraon and decelera-
on of the trains. When momentum is at maximum and you move the throle from the minimum to the
maximum, the train will slowly accelerate from a stop to the maximum speed. Similarly if the throle is
moved quickly from maximum to 0, the train will slowly decelerate to a stop. Momentum adds another
dimension of realism to your model railroad. In addion, the combinaon of speed governor and mo-
mentum makes it easier to limit derailments when younger engineers are at the controls.
• Direcon Control:
The Mag Mate has a direcon control switch which will change the direcon of the locomove. If the
locomove runs backwards when the switch is in the forward posion, reverse the connecons going to
the track.
• Overload Protecon:
In the event of an overload, the Mag Mate has an automac thermal cuto inside the controller, which
will be acvated in the event of an overload. This will reset itself automacally in 2-3 minutes aer the
cause of the overload is removed.
